On Sunday 15 February 2026, Power Town Festival will take place at Strange Brew, Bristol, from 1pm to 11pm.

Power Town Festival is a full-day, family-friendly celebration of music, culture and community, created to champion Black and Global Majority artists and celebrate African and Caribbean culture in Bristol. The festival is delivered by Creative Power Town, a Black-led organisation based in St Paul’s, with a strong focus on turning community talent into professional opportunity.

The festival is headlined by Donae’o, one of the most influential voices in UK music, alongside Kenny Allstar of Radio 1Xtra, Kwazy fresh from Glastonbury Festival, and a showcase of Bristol grassroot artists and Creative Power Town’s Artist Development Programme graduates.

Alongside live music, the programme includes a Bristol vs Birmingham DJ clash and African and Caribbean food traders.
